  • Simple API
    Agentmemory provides a straightforward and minimal API for creating, searching, updating, and deleting memories, making it easy for developers to integrate memory capabilities into AI agents without dealing with complex configurations.
  • Built on ChromaDB
    It leverages ChromaDB as its underlying vector database, providing reliable semantic search and embedding capabilities out of the box without requiring developers to set up separate infrastructure.
  • Lightweight and Easy to Install
    Agentmemory is a lightweight Python package that can be installed via pip with minimal dependencies, making it quick to get started with and easy to incorporate into existing projects.
  • Category-Based Memory Organization
    Memories can be organized into categories (topics), allowing agents to store and retrieve information in a structured way, which helps with context management and retrieval accuracy.
  • No Server Required
    Agentmemory can run entirely locally without needing a separate server or cloud service, making it suitable for development, prototyping, and privacy-sensitive applications where data should stay on the local machine.

Possible disadvantages

  • Limited Ecosystem and Community
    Agentmemory is a relatively niche and small project with a limited community compared to more established memory and vector database solutions, which means fewer resources, tutorials, and community support are available.
  • Basic Feature Set
    While simplicity is a strength, the library may lack advanced features such as sophisticated memory consolidation, decay mechanisms, importance scoring, or complex querying capabilities that more mature memory frameworks offer.
  • Tight Coupling to ChromaDB
    Being built specifically on ChromaDB means developers are locked into that particular vector store and cannot easily swap it out for alternatives like Pinecone, Weaviate, or FAISS without significant refactoring.
  • Limited Scalability
    As a locally-run, lightweight solution, Agentmemory may not scale well for production applications that require handling large volumes of memories, high concurrency, or distributed deployments.
  • Sparse Documentation and Examples
    The project's documentation, while covering the basics, may lack comprehensive examples, best practices, and advanced usage patterns that developers need when building complex agent-based systems.

What makes your product unique?

GetProbe.xyz's answer:

Probe is the only tool that checks AI agent-specific protocols like x402 payment headers, ERC-8004 on-chain identity, and EU AI Act Article 14 human oversight signals — alongside traditional security checks like SSL/TLS, DNSSEC, and DMARC. No other compliance scanner covers the AI agent economy stack.

Why should a person choose your product over its competitors?

GetProbe.xyz's answer:

Most compliance tools focus on GDPR or generic web security. Probe covers 32 checks across both traditional security AND emerging AI agent protocols (x402, MCP, agent.json, Google A2A). It runs in under 5 seconds, requires no signup, and provides a public leaderboard so you can benchmark against 200+ APIs instantly.

How would you describe the primary audience of your product?

GetProbe.xyz's answer:

AI agent developers, API providers, DevOps engineers, and compliance teams who need to verify that APIs meet security, trust, and regulatory standards before integration. Especially relevant for teams building in the x402/MCP/A2A agent economy.

What's the story behind your product?

GetProbe.xyz's answer:

We built Probe because AI agents are starting to pay for and consume APIs autonomously — but there was no way to verify if an API is trustworthy before an agent sends money to it. Probe started as an internal tool at AsterPay to audit x402-compatible APIs, then grew into a standalone compliance platform covering 32 checks across security, identity, and regulation.

Which are the primary technologies used for building your product?

GetProbe.xyz's answer:

Cloudflare Pages & Pages Functions (serverless edge), Supabase (PostgreSQL), vanilla JavaScript (zero framework frontend), DNS-over-HTTPS for DNSSEC/DMARC checks, Certificate Transparency logs for SSL analysis, and on-chain RPC calls for ERC-8004 verification.
